ABSTRACT In a tool for pruning small trees and shrubs, it is known to comprise of a main vertical support, a horizontal arm, a vertical jig-mounting member and a set of main revolving jigs assembled with the use of sleeves, in such a way that it makes pruning a very simple operation for one person. In this invention, the main vertical support, horizontal arm and vertical jig-mounting member all serve as supports for the revolving jig used as a guide for the pruning operation. The jigs are of several shapes depending on the final product desired. The invention shows jigs of the following shapes: ball, bell, diamond, clover and bottle. SPECIFICATION This invention relates to a one-person operable jig for pruning small trees and/or shrubs to a desired shape by eliminating all guess work on the part of the pruner. In pruning trees and shrubs to specified shapes it is not known that any such previous tool has been utilized before. The pruning of trees is normally done by "eye-balling" which is not accurate or evenly done. This invention introduces a jig which is rotated at will that removes all the guess work that pruning entails and the result is an absolutely even and balanced pruned plant. In drawings which illustrate embodiments of the invention, Figure 1 is an elevation of assembled invention with closer views of cross-shaped sleeves 4 and simple sleeve 6. Figure 2 is an elevation view of the main revolving jigs: ball-shaped 7, bell-shaped 7a, diamond-shaped 7b, clover-shaped 7c and bottle-shaped 7d.
